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67283781751 3200101893 503
72584289 85515627 82451363
72584289 85515627 82451363
906196098 91 650
All about undefined
Interested in learning more?
72584289 85515627 82451363
906196098 91 650
See more
356721 085 17715788982
0215 5529328356 98085756996
See more
9753846630 827
08145 144 2370 92317
See more